摘要
随着工业4.0的提出,网络化是工业产品发展的必然趋势。提出了一种驱动器集成多种工业总线的方法,主要解决多总线统一、多轴在驱动控制级别的同步问题。与采用多个总线并行实现的方法不同,提供了一种基于IEC 61800-7的统一架构和接口。该架构的通信模型分为物理层、协议层、接口层和驱动应用层。协议层上层主要基于IEC 61800-7-201标准;接口层则对协议层进行封装,提供面向驱动的、统一的函数接口、对象集合和对象字典,最关键的是多轴驱动的同步接口;驱动应用层用于实现IEC 61800-7-301协议的功能,并以该协议作为驱动开发的核心,而不仅仅作为数据接口。在驱动器上实现了上述多工业总线的集成功能,它具有较高的灵活性和可扩展性。最后,通过实验验证了该方法的可行性,以及多轴的同步性能。
This paper proposes a method of drivers that can integrate multiple fieldbuses,such as ETHERNET Powerlink,EtherCAT,CANOpen,solved the synchronization of multi-axis at the motor control level,e.g.PWM interrupt,and provided an u- nified framework and interface according to IEC 61800-7.The communication model of the framework is divided to a physi- cal layer,a protocol layer,an interface layer and the driver application layer.The up protocol layer is based on IEC 61800-7- 201.The interface layer encapsulates the protocol layer and provide a consistent programming interface.The application layer realizes the IEC 61800-7-301 standard.Then this paper gives the implementation of above fieldbus on a driver,which demonstrated the flexibility and scalability.
出处
《工业控制计算机》
2018年第11期3-5,共3页
Industrial Control Computer